Abstract :
For the detection of reverse power flow in medium-voltage networks, induction-disc-type relays are usually employed. This paper describes a simple phase-detection relay which is capable of indicating revers power flow in certain types of network. The relay described uses the characteristics of Zener diodes and is simple in design, cheap in cost and is capable of extensive application. The performance of a laboratory-prototype relay under steady-state and transient conditions is described. It is shown that the relay operates irrespective of the phases on which the fault occurs. A linear coupler from which the current signal can be derived helps to reduce unwanted transient effects.
